en The biggest thing is that, the reason we've had trouble running the ball so far, is that we keep going against three down linemen fronts. And that's just different. It's unorthodox. It's a whole new different set of blocking schemes. (Tulane) runs what we do, four down linemen. And it's just so much more natural. That's what we played against most of last year, and that's why Howard Jackson had the year he did. Because that's what we were used to and it's just basic blocking.

en John and Fred did a great job. They did an outstanding job. I thought our backs did a real good job of helping. You're not going to leave (the linemen) blocking them one-on-one all day. The backs have to get involved. You have to change up your protection. You can't just drop back several steps and ask those guys to block them all day. You have to run the football, which is first and foremost with us. And then you've got to change up the looks and the protection.
